Assessment interface

Recurso de avaliação do computador.

Extends

Propriedades

assessmentErrorSummary

Obtém ou define o resumo do erro de avaliação. Esse é o número de computadores afetados por cada tipo de erro nesta avaliação.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

assessmentType

Tipo de avaliação da avaliação.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

azureDiskTypes

Obtém ou define o tipo de armazenamento do azure. Premium, Padrão etc.

azureHybridUseBenefit

Obtém ou define a configuração configurável do usuário para exibir o benefício de uso híbrido do azure.

azureLocation

Local do Azure ou região do Azure para onde os computadores serão migrados.

azureOfferCode

Código de Oferta do Azure.

azurePricingTier

Obtém ou define o Tipo de Preço do Azure – Gratuito, Básico etc.

azureStorageRedundancy

Obtém ou define a Redundância de Armazenamento do Azure. Exemplo: armazenamento com redundância local.

azureVmFamilies

Obtém ou define as famílias de VM do Azure.

confidenceRatingInPercentage

Classificação de confiança em porcentagem.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

costComponents

Obtém a coleção de componentes de custo.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

createdTimestamp

Data e hora em que a avaliação foi criada.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

currency

Moeda na qual os preços devem ser relatados.

discountPercentage

Percentual de desconto personalizado.

distributionByOsName

Obtém a distribuição por nome do sistema operacional.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

distributionByServicePackInsight

Obtém a distribuição de distribuição de sqlInstances pelo insight do service pack.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

distributionBySupportStatus

Obtém a distribuição de sqlInstances pelo status de suporte.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

eaSubscriptionId

Obtém ou define a ID da assinatura do contrato empresarial.

groupType

Obtém o tipo de grupo para a avaliação.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

monthlyBandwidthCost

Obtém ou define o custo de largura de banda agregado para todos os computadores na avaliação.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

monthlyComputeCost

Obtém ou define o custo de computação agregado para todos os computadores na avaliação.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

monthlyPremiumStorageCost

Obtém ou define o custo de armazenamento premium agregado para todos os computadores na avaliação.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

monthlyStandardSsdStorageCost

Obtém ou define o custo de armazenamento SSD padrão agregado para todos os computadores na avaliação.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

monthlyStorageCost

Obtém ou define o custo de armazenamento agregado para todos os computadores na avaliação.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

monthlyUltraStorageCost

Obtém ou define o custo de armazenamento ultra agregado para todos os computadores na avaliação.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

numberOfMachines

Obtém ou define a parte Número de computadores da avaliação.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

percentile

Percentil dos valores de dados de utilização a serem considerados durante a avaliação de computadores.

perfDataEndTime

Obtém ou define a hora de término para considerar os dados de desempenho para avaliação.

perfDataStartTime

Obtém ou define a hora de início para considerar os dados de desempenho para avaliação.

pricesTimestamp

Última vez em que as taxas foram consultadas.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

provisioningState

O status da última operação.

reservedInstance

Obtém ou define a Instância Reservada do Azure – 1 ano, 3 anos.

scalingFactor

Porcentagem de buffer desejado pelo usuário em métricas de desempenho ao recomendar tamanhos do Azure.

schemaVersion

Versão do esquema.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

sizingCriterion

Critério de dimensionamento de avaliação.

stage

Configuração configurável do usuário para exibir o Estágio da Avaliação.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

status

Se a avaliação está em estado válido e todos os computadores foram avaliados.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

suitabilitySummary

Obtém ou define o resumo de adequação da nuvem para todos os computadores na avaliação.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

timeRange

Intervalo de Tempo para o qual os dados de utilização históricos devem ser considerados para avaliação.

updatedTimestamp

Data e hora em que a avaliação foi atualizada pela última vez.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

vmUptime

Obtém ou define a duração para a qual as VMs estão ativas no ambiente local.

Propriedades herdadas

id

ID de recurso totalmente qualificada para o recurso. Ex - /subscriptions/{subscriptionId}/resourceGroups/{resourceGroupName}/providers/{resourceProviderNamespace}/{resourceType}/{resourceName} O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

name

O nome do recurso O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

systemData

Metadados do Azure Resource Manager que contêm informações createdBy e modifiedBy.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

type

O tipo do recurso. Por exemplo, "Microsoft.Compute/virtualMachines" ou "Microsoft.Storage/storageAccounts" O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

Detalhes da propriedade

assessmentErrorSummary

Obtém ou define o resumo do erro de avaliação. Esse é o número de computadores afetados por cada tipo de erro nesta avaliação.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

assessmentErrorSummary?: {[propertyName: string]: number}

Valor da propriedade

{[propertyName: string]: number}

assessmentType

Tipo de avaliação da avaliação.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

assessmentType?: string

Valor da propriedade

string

azureDiskTypes

Obtém ou define o tipo de armazenamento do azure. Premium, Padrão etc.

azureDiskTypes?: string[]

Valor da propriedade

string[]

azureHybridUseBenefit

Obtém ou define a configuração configurável do usuário para exibir o benefício de uso híbrido do azure.

azureHybridUseBenefit?: string

Valor da propriedade

string

azureLocation

Local do Azure ou região do Azure para onde os computadores serão migrados.

azureLocation?: string

Valor da propriedade

string

azureOfferCode

Código de Oferta do Azure.

azureOfferCode?: string

Valor da propriedade

string

azurePricingTier

Obtém ou define o Tipo de Preço do Azure – Gratuito, Básico etc.

azurePricingTier?: string

Valor da propriedade

string

azureStorageRedundancy

Obtém ou define a Redundância de Armazenamento do Azure. Exemplo: armazenamento com redundância local.

azureStorageRedundancy?: string

Valor da propriedade

string

azureVmFamilies

Obtém ou define as famílias de VM do Azure.

azureVmFamilies?: string[]

Valor da propriedade

string[]

confidenceRatingInPercentage

Classificação de confiança em porcentagem.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

confidenceRatingInPercentage?: number

Valor da propriedade

number

costComponents

Obtém a coleção de componentes de custo.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

costComponents?: CostComponent[]

Valor da propriedade

createdTimestamp

Data e hora em que a avaliação foi criada.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

createdTimestamp?: Date

Valor da propriedade

Date

currency

Moeda na qual os preços devem ser relatados.

currency?: string

Valor da propriedade

string

discountPercentage

Percentual de desconto personalizado.

discountPercentage?: number

Valor da propriedade

number

distributionByOsName

Obtém a distribuição por nome do sistema operacional.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

distributionByOsName?: {[propertyName: string]: number}

Valor da propriedade

{[propertyName: string]: number}

distributionByServicePackInsight

Obtém a distribuição de distribuição de sqlInstances pelo insight do service pack.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

distributionByServicePackInsight?: {[propertyName: string]: number}

Valor da propriedade

{[propertyName: string]: number}

distributionBySupportStatus

Obtém a distribuição de sqlInstances pelo status de suporte.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

distributionBySupportStatus?: {[propertyName: string]: number}

Valor da propriedade

{[propertyName: string]: number}

eaSubscriptionId

Obtém ou define a ID da assinatura do contrato empresarial.

eaSubscriptionId?: string

Valor da propriedade

string

groupType

Obtém o tipo de grupo para a avaliação.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

groupType?: string

Valor da propriedade

string

monthlyBandwidthCost

Obtém ou define o custo de largura de banda agregado para todos os computadores na avaliação.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

monthlyBandwidthCost?: number

Valor da propriedade

number

monthlyComputeCost

Obtém ou define o custo de computação agregado para todos os computadores na avaliação.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

monthlyComputeCost?: number

Valor da propriedade

number

monthlyPremiumStorageCost

Obtém ou define o custo de armazenamento premium agregado para todos os computadores na avaliação.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

monthlyPremiumStorageCost?: number

Valor da propriedade

number

monthlyStandardSsdStorageCost

Obtém ou define o custo de armazenamento SSD padrão agregado para todos os computadores na avaliação.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

monthlyStandardSsdStorageCost?: number

Valor da propriedade

number

monthlyStorageCost

Obtém ou define o custo de armazenamento agregado para todos os computadores na avaliação.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

monthlyStorageCost?: number

Valor da propriedade

number

monthlyUltraStorageCost

Obtém ou define o custo de armazenamento ultra agregado para todos os computadores na avaliação.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

monthlyUltraStorageCost?: number

Valor da propriedade

number

numberOfMachines

Obtém ou define a parte Número de computadores da avaliação.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

numberOfMachines?: number

Valor da propriedade

number

percentile

Percentil dos valores de dados de utilização a serem considerados durante a avaliação de computadores.

percentile?: string

Valor da propriedade

string

perfDataEndTime

Obtém ou define a hora de término para considerar os dados de desempenho para avaliação.

perfDataEndTime?: Date

Valor da propriedade

Date

perfDataStartTime

Obtém ou define a hora de início para considerar os dados de desempenho para avaliação.

perfDataStartTime?: Date

Valor da propriedade

Date

pricesTimestamp

Última vez em que as taxas foram consultadas.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

pricesTimestamp?: Date

Valor da propriedade

Date

provisioningState

O status da última operação.

provisioningState?: string

Valor da propriedade

string

reservedInstance

Obtém ou define a Instância Reservada do Azure – 1 ano, 3 anos.

reservedInstance?: string

Valor da propriedade

string

scalingFactor

Porcentagem de buffer desejado pelo usuário em métricas de desempenho ao recomendar tamanhos do Azure.

scalingFactor?: number

Valor da propriedade

number

schemaVersion

Versão do esquema.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

schemaVersion?: string

Valor da propriedade

string

sizingCriterion

Critério de dimensionamento de avaliação.

sizingCriterion?: string

Valor da propriedade

string

stage

Configuração configurável do usuário para exibir o Estágio da Avaliação.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

stage?: string

Valor da propriedade

string

status

Se a avaliação está em estado válido e todos os computadores foram avaliados.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

status?: string

Valor da propriedade

string

suitabilitySummary

Obtém ou define o resumo de adequação da nuvem para todos os computadores na avaliação.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

suitabilitySummary?: {[propertyName: string]: number}

Valor da propriedade

{[propertyName: string]: number}

timeRange

Intervalo de Tempo para o qual os dados de utilização históricos devem ser considerados para avaliação.

timeRange?: string

Valor da propriedade

string

updatedTimestamp

Data e hora em que a avaliação foi atualizada pela última vez.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

updatedTimestamp?: Date

Valor da propriedade

Date

vmUptime

Obtém ou define a duração para a qual as VMs estão ativas no ambiente local.

vmUptime?: VmUptime

Valor da propriedade

Detalhes das propriedades herdadas

id

ID de recurso totalmente qualificada para o recurso. Ex - /subscriptions/{subscriptionId}/resourceGroups/{resourceGroupName}/providers/{resourceProviderNamespace}/{resourceType}/{resourceName} O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

id?: string

Valor da propriedade

string

herdado deProxyResource.id

name

O nome do recurso O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

name?: string

Valor da propriedade

string

herdado deProxyResource.name

systemData

Metadados do Azure Resource Manager que contêm informações createdBy e modifiedBy.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

systemData?: SystemData

Valor da propriedade

herdado de ProxyResource.systemData

type

O tipo do recurso. Por exemplo, "Microsoft.Compute/virtualMachines" ou "Microsoft.Storage/storageAccounts" O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

type?: string

Valor da propriedade

string

herdado deProxyResource.type